Output ddc2d34d4db0517772431a21c0297b434bbe470664c8c9387b750520b144f6c9:0

value
2299033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b76fca0ca71020aaec40847351c4d2c7d251137 OP_EQUAL
address
3PA3FyRiXC72Qix19ioZRyPAN6rPeDKfVW
transaction
ddc2d34d4db0517772431a21c0297b434bbe470664c8c9387b750520b144f6c9
confirmations
411606
spent
true